A easy example: edit reference of Element
This button is inside the attributes-toolbar.
The attributes-toolbar for the Design(Top-Files) is inside
Code: Select all
C:\Missler\V6xx\bin\top.icn
Code: Select all
#Men#Attribute#Reference #0,3041,14 = CATEGORY "#Icn#Category#Attributes" INTERRUPT $TOPHOME/d/l/setref 10 ;
When you install the Module Top-Lip you will get for many lob-files also the lip-files. The lipfiles are the sourcecode.
Code: Select all
C:/Missler/V6xx/d/l/setref.lip
The following rows shows the definition of needed variables.
Code: Select all
LABEL label
LABEL labroot
LABEL labset
STRING ref
STRING des
INT n
INT nf
INT typf
STRING propname
INT break
INT exit
INT stop
INT ch
INT answ
The next rows shows the steps from our button.
There are a lot of "if" "else" and so on.
I know from the lip help file "C:\Missler\V614\local\englishUS\TopLIP.doc"
that the variable type "LABEL" is a mix of current document ID and Element ID (@123).
! = write in variable
? = read from variable
Take a look on these code in row 108
Code: Select all
label? DWcrerootifgen label! labroot!
labroot = label = DWcrerootifgen of label-value
I am not 100% sure but these code generated the needed LABEL for the next step.
Now take a look to the main Code. It is only one row.
Code: Select all
labroot? ref? DWsetrefprop
DWsetrefprop ref-value for labroot
This code fill in the our wanted ref.value inside a element.
So here a example of my knowlege about this self-studie.
Code: Select all
(define the needed variable for ElemntID as integer)
INT elementid
(define the mixing Variable for ElementID and DocID as label)
LABEL labroot
(define the needed variable for Refvalue as string)
STRING refvalue
(set the Label with ElementID=@57 without @)
57 elementid!
(set the ref-text inside the variable refvalue)
"text123" refvalue!
(mix and set ElementID with docID. I found this code in a other lip-file)
DDOCWgetcrtid elementid? BuildLabelFromIdentifiers labroot!
(fill in the reftext for our element)
labroot? refvalue? DWsetrefprop
(exit this lip/lop file)
QuitMacro
1. You need to save the code above inside C:\editref.lip
2. You need an Element with the correct ID @57 or you change the code for this test.
3. You need to convert the lip to a lob file (cmd= C:\Missler\V614\toplip.exe C:\editref.lip) Module TopLip have to be already installed.
4. You need a working test-VB-Projekt with TopSolid API
5. Use this code to activate our lob file
Code: Select all
IApplication.ExecuteMacro(C:\editref.lob)
This code does only work for one element.
The next learning step comes after first positive experience with this example
good luck

Re: INDEX NAME
Hi
These properties are work both command SetTextProperty - GetTextProperty
$comment
$zmld_stock
$designation
$zmld_ref
$reference
$zmld_std
$supplier
$processing
These properties are work only GetTextProperty
$bom_index_name
$bom_index_key
$zmld_machinedcompo
$show_bom_detail
$zmld_view
example
1. u want to get the supplier
string = TopElt.Element.GetTextProperty("$supplier")
2. you want to set the supplier
TopElt.Element.GetTextProperty("$supplier", "what you want to set")

Re: INDEX NAME
HI.
I think analyse is only work with volume and area in 3d
double = element.Analyse(TopSolid.TopAnalyse.topVolume)
double = element.Analyse(TopSolid.TopAnalyse.topArea)
where the element is TopSolid.Element
I'hve tried to get somehow the lenght, width, tickness still no sucess. I think there is no option in API
Now i working a project
the main function is:
1.) call a .lob macro witch is get the property and pushing in the stack
2.) and the API read that stack "Value = IApplication.GetDoubleFromStack"
Maybe it will be work.
